When looking for eye cream, I am interested in the ingredients and what it may do for my concerns around the eyes.  Vine Vera’s products contain Resveratrol, which is found in red wine,and  “is a potent antioxidant over three times more effective than vitamin C and over four and a half times more than vitamin. Resveratrol effectively neutralizes oxidants harmful to health and has been shown to prolong the life of cells by up to 70%.”

At the moment, I do not have dark circles, but I would like to reduce the wrinkles around the corners of my eyes. Those wonderful crow’s feet. As noted in my last post, I do enjoy the serums slightly more than the cream, as it is a thinner consistancy and a fresh smell.  The first product I tried was the Cabernet High Potency Contour Eye Cream. It was thicker with a light scent and I used just a bit to dab. The other product was the Resveratrol Cabernet High Potency Eye Serum.

I have tried both products for almost 2 months. As with any skin care, I feel it takes at least 8 weeks if not longer to see results. I can say I noticed just a slight improvement in wrinkles near my eyes. My skin is dry this time of the year and they did provide some added moisture. I do prefer a gel-like serum to a thick cream, so upon choosing, I would prefer the serum over the heavier eye cream.

Resversatrol is becoming an ingredient in which more and more people are familiar. All of Vine Vera’s product contains this ingredient. I like the cooling sensation that it gives when I apply it. I use one to two pumps in the morning and evening with it’s gel like texture it goes on smoothly.  The three main ingredients are Resveratrol ( Pichia/ Resveratrol Ferment Extract), Palmitoyl Oligopeptide and Vitamin C. I do notice that the texture of my skin seems smoother, but I do believe it will take more than the 8 weeks I have tried to notice a decrease in fine lines. I did notice a slight softening.  I will continue to use Vine Vera!
